How does loan-to-value (LTV) affect the borrowing and lending of digital assets?
Can you explain how the loan-to-value (LTV) ratio impacts the process of borrowing and lending digital assets? What are the implications for borrowers and lenders?
3 answers
- Nilesh UttekarJul 29, 2021 · 5 years agoThe loan-to-value (LTV) ratio plays a crucial role in the borrowing and lending of digital assets. It represents the ratio of the loan amount to the value of the collateral provided. A higher LTV ratio means borrowers can obtain a larger loan amount relative to the value of their collateral. This can be beneficial for borrowers who need access to liquidity without having to sell their digital assets. However, a higher LTV ratio also increases the risk for lenders, as they have a higher chance of not recovering the full loan amount in the event of default. Lenders may require higher interest rates or additional collateral to mitigate this risk.
- Melad HaniFeb 23, 2023 · 3 years agoWhen it comes to borrowing and lending digital assets, the loan-to-value (LTV) ratio is a key factor to consider. This ratio determines the maximum loan amount that borrowers can obtain based on the value of their collateral. For example, if the LTV ratio is 50%, a borrower can borrow up to 50% of the value of their collateral. This provides borrowers with the flexibility to access funds without selling their digital assets. On the other hand, lenders face the risk of potential default. To mitigate this risk, lenders may set lower LTV ratios or require additional collateral. It's important for both borrowers and lenders to carefully consider the LTV ratio and its implications before engaging in borrowing or lending activities.
